| Title: | Pansystems optimization, generalized principles of optimality, and fundamental equations of dynamic programming |
| Authors: | Chen, Bei-fang |
| Keywords: | Mathematical modelling Model Optimization |
| Issue Date: | 1997 |
| Citation: | The international journal of systems and cybernetics, v. 26, no. 3, 1997, p. 316-333 |
| Abstract: | Clarifies the relationship between the Bellman principle of optimality and the recursive functional equation of dynamic programming by optimum operators of pansystems methodology. Instead of the Bellman principle of optimality, two generalized principles of optimality are proposed by which a necessary and sufficient condition for the fundamental equation is obtained. A discrete generalized dynamic programming model is set up in detail. Some discrete optimization problems which cannot be treated by ordinary dynamic programming may be solved by the generalized model with the construction of appropriate optimum operators. |
